- Common Name: Cranesbill
- A mound-forming cultivar, well-covered with large flowers held well above the foliage from early to mid-summer. Flowers are pinkish magenta with darker red-purple veins that unite at the centre
- Foliage: Deciduous. Habit: Bushy.
- Position: Sun or part shade. Aspect: North Facing, South Facing, East Facing, West Facing.
- Soil: Chalk, clay, loam, and sand. Moiture: Moist but well-drained and well-drained. pH: Acid, alklaine, neutral.
- Ultimate height: 0.5-1m. Time to ultimate height: 2-5 years. Ultimate spread: 1.5-2.5m.
- Suggested Planting Locations: Cottage and informal gardens, Gravel gardens, Flower borders and beds, Ground cover, Underplanting of roses and shrubs.
